Gattaca

Innate determinism provides the foundation pertaining to Andrew Niccols science fictional film Gattaca. The film serves as a cautionary adventure for their particular, by raising questions about genetic determinism, and the problems it could cause of us in the not-too-distant long term. Niccol signals the viewers to the principles displayed inside the film, such as burden of excellence, discrimination and the strength of the human spirit are brought up, and enables the viewers to consider their own wants for a best future contemporary society.

As the invalids of society suffer from discrimination, the valids are forced to withstand their own, exclusive hardship, the duty of efficiency, which proves to detrimentally impact the elite. One of the most obvious victims of this burden was the wheelchair-bound demigod Jerome Morrow. With superb innate gifts, for instance a heart of the ox and IQ from the register, Jerome is genetically determined for glory. However , he sunk into a your life of self-loathing abuse, finding solace in alcoholic beverages after putting second within a swimming race. When the viewer first fulfills Jerome, he’s displayed since attractive guy, miserably confined to a wheelchair. He shows up from in back of a expoliar, as if having been concealing him self from the pity of his failure. In an outburst of honesty, Jerome tells Vincent, [I] was never intended to be one step down on the podium. This suggests to the viewers that Jeromes belief in the own innate perfection was shattered following your loss, and he is not able to cope with the failure this individual endured. This same coping difficulty is distributed and experienced by Vincents valid close friend, Anton Freeman. He displays excessive cockiness and braggadocio before the second swimming landscape with Vincent, by declaring Youre be certain to want to do this? You know they are going to drop. This illustrates Antons opinion in his very own genetic durability, and that he has the ability to of obtaining his desired goals without efforts or determination. After being defeated by simply Vincent hanging around of poultry, Anton is left confounded by his failure, battling to comprehend how his unacceptable brother, while using genetic probabilities stacked so severely against him, surely could achieve the impossible. If the two are reunited during Antons exploration into the murder of the Mission Director, Vincent references his defeat of Anton, triggering Anton to protect himself, stating, You couldnt beat myself that time. I conquer myself. This kind of displays again that Anton cannot comprehend Vincents accomplishment, whether in the water or perhaps in the office buildings of Gattaca, he will not understand the strength of Vincents human heart, and what enables him to accomplish. He only sees one side of the struggle, his individual. He sights himself while perfection incarnate, so his loss can only be explained by a lack of work on his own portion. The lives of Jerome and Anton serve to exhibit the adverse consequences caused the burden of perfection, and the fact that however, elite within a genetically-focused culture will be imperfect.

The society in Gattaca disregard biblical morality by styling what The almighty hath produced crooked, genetically determining the life and future of a child although they are even now in utero, thus placing the fate of their kid in the hands of scientific research, rather than Our god. This practice almost right away creates a great upper and lower course, due to the fact that valids are definitely the excellent candidates for every role in society, departing the invalids to partake in undesirable jobs. After running away from home to chase his dream of reaching the stars, Vincent falls patient to his genes if he is forced to get a cleaner, one of the only mobilisation he is in a position of attaining. Although cleaning the windows of Gattaca Aerospace Corporations office buildings, Vincent is usually told by the head janitor Caesar, Don’t clean the glass too wellyou might get tips. When Vincent retorts, declaring [but] if its clean, itll be easier to observe me on the reverse side, Caesar laughs in his encounter, seemingly acquiring Vincents remark as being in jest. Caesars reaction suggests that society in general has become accepting the fact that invalids are never capable of reaching high-level roles in society. Qualities such as willpower and man spirit have got long since been forgotten, genes would be the quintessential measuring stick for a humans potential. An additional instance of discrimination happens once again inside the offices in the Gattaca Businesses offices. After adopting the identity of Jerome Morrow, Vincent applies for a position at Gattaca. Following a urine sample test out, Vincent is usually congratulated simply by Dr . Lamar on his fresh job. Vincent is amazed, and requests, What about the interview?, where Lamar responds, That was it. This kind of hiring practice blatantly transgresses the Genoism Law, as being a candidate may not be hired or perhaps rejected based upon their inherited genes. The fact the fact that Gattaca Corporation are willing to break the law advises a window blind faith inside the success of the person if they retain the correct innate code. Unquantifiable traits, such as the human soul and determination, are completely disregarded, but as Vincent states, For the genetically excellent, success is easier to attain, nevertheless by no means guaranteed. After all there is not any gene intended for fate. These instances of splendour display the society of Gattaca have found trust technology of genetic determinism, rather than rely on the strength of Gods work.

Whilst genetic determinism heavily favors those of a superior genetic account, success remains attainable for anyone with second-rate genetic structure. The perfect sort of human heart defying impossible odds also comes in the form of Vincent Freeman. A beliefs birth, Vincent is placed in an undesirable interpersonal position by birth, great dream immediately becomes to escape his success on Earth and reach the stars. The only way to achieve his dream is to turn into a borrowed corporate or a de-gene-rate. It was through this process that Vincent exhibited his man spirit. In order to feign the identity of 61 Jerome Morrow, 511 Vincent was forced to withstand an extremely agonizing limb-lengthening medical procedures in his hip and legs, but due to incredible courage, Vincent surely could withstand it, as he understood that the procedure was required in order to achieve his dream. He was in a position to put mind over matter, ignore the soreness and give attention to his aim. His cruciform position on the ground of Jeromes apartment represents how Vincent is leaving his id to achieve his dream, in the same problematic vein as Christ, when he sacrificed his life for the sins of humanity. One more clear example of Vincents man spirit happens in the third and final game of chicken played out between Anton and Vincent. When Anton suggests that each of them swim back to the safety with the shore, Vincent finally shows to Anton how he was capable of defeating Anton in the representational game of chicken, which will truly represents Vincents have difficulties against the hereditary discrimination this individual faces, This is the way I did that Anton. We never preserved anything intended for the swim back. This kind of mantra encapsulates Vincents figure, he invest of his efforts in to assuring his passage to space, without the thought of what would happen when he returned. This individual never inhibited his very own physical abilities, and put all his faith into his mental power and perseverance to achieve his goal.
